  • Philadelphia: Known as the birthplace of American democracy, Philadelphia is a bustling metropolis rich in history and culture. Located in the southeastern part of Pennsylvania, this city offers a diverse travel experience with a mix of family-friendly activities and vibrant urban life. Visitors will find themselves immersed in its iconic landmarks such as the Liberty Bell and Independence Hall. Philadelphia's renowned arts scene is highlighted by the Philadelphia Museum of Art, while shopping districts like Rittenhouse Square provide ample retail therapy.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y Fairmount Park, which offers scenic trails and recreational opportunities. The city truly shines during the summer months, making it a great time to explore its many festivals and events.
  • Pittsburgh: Nestled at the confluence of three rivers, Pittsburgh is a dynamic metropolis in western Pennsylvania that boasts a unique blend of industrial heritage and modern innovation. The city is known for its friendly atmosphere and vibrant neighborhoods. Travelers flock to Pittsburgh for family adventures, city exploration, and outdoor activities. Popular attractions include the Andy Warhol Museum and PNC Park, home to the Pittsburgh Pirates. Families can enjoy a day at the Pittsburgh Zoo & PPG Aquarium or explore the interactive exhibits at the Carnegie Science Center. The peak travel seasons in the summer and fall offer numerous festivals and events, showcasing the city's cultural offerings.
  • Lancaster: Located in the heart of Pennsylvania Dutch Country, Lancaster is a charming city that offers a unique blend of rural and urban experiences. Known for its Amish heritage, visitors are drawn to Lancaster for family outings, outdoor activities, and entertainment options. The city features attractions such as Dutch Wonderland amusement park and the historic Fulton Theatre, providing fun for all ages. Nature lovers can explore the surrounding countryside while enjoying picturesque views and fresh produce from local markets. With peak visitor numbers in the summer, Lancaster is a great place to experience culture, history, and the scenic beauty of Pennsylvania.

Best time to go to Pennsylvania

Visitor numbers in Pennsylvania is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Pennsylvania is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January26.6°F (-3.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February29.5°F (-1.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March39.9°F (4.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April50.5°F (10.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June64.9°F (18.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
July72.1°F (22.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August71.1°F (21.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September65.3°F (18.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October56.5°F (13.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November42.3°F (5.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December32.9°F (0.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
